ANNE CLAUDE PHILIPPE DE TUBIÈRES, COMTE DE CAYLUS

1692 – Paris – 1765

 

No.64  Homme debout [Standing man] – before 1728

 

Etching on laid paper. Size of sheet: 19.8 x 12.5 cm. Lettered: ‘Watteau In. –Cx Scul’. Numbered “64” in the plate. From the Suite de figures inventées par Watteau et gravées par son ami C*** - a series of 24 plates after the figures invented by Antoine Watteau (French, 1684-1721).

 

IFF 4:464 (19); Rosenberg, 1997 (Vol.2, fig. 165b); Goncourt, 1896, Watteau, p.312-313.

 

It is after a drawing in sanguine now in the Louvre Museum (inv.33377) (Rosenberg, 1997, No.165, p.256).
